TCS Shares Wobble Amidst Bold AI Bet and Mammoth Real Estate Expansion

In a significant development that sent ripples through the market, shares of India's IT behemoth, Tata Consultancy Services (TCS), experienced a dip of over 2% today. The decline came as investors digested reports of two major strategic moves by the company: the establishment of an ambitious new Artificial Intelligence (AI) unit and a colossal Rs 2,130 crore office space lease deal in Mumbai.

The market's immediate reaction suggests a cautious approach from investors, who are carefully weighing the short-term capital commitments against the long-term growth potential these initiatives promise.

While the formation of a dedicated AI unit signals TCS's unwavering focus on future technologies and innovation, the sheer scale of the investment, coupled with a massive real estate acquisition, appears to have triggered some profit-booking and uncertainty.

Sources indicate that the new AI unit is poised to be a cornerstone of TCS's strategy to deepen its capabilities in generative AI, machine learning, and advanced analytics.

This move is crucial in the rapidly evolving digital landscape, where AI is no longer a futuristic concept but a vital tool for competitive advantage. The unit is expected to drive the development of cutting-edge solutions, foster talent, and accelerate AI adoption across TCS's extensive client base, positioning the company at the forefront of the AI revolution.

Parallel to this technological push is the monumental Rs 2,130 crore lease agreement for new office premises in Mumbai.

This multi-year deal underscores TCS's commitment to expanding its physical footprint and accommodating its growing workforce, potentially linking to the scaling up of its new AI operations and other strategic business units. Such a substantial investment in real estate highlights the company's long-term vision for growth and its confidence in India's economic trajectory and talent pool.
